Management Meeting Minutes — Harrowfield Trading Co.

Attendees: R. Velmont, S. Okari, D. Prentiss. The committee approved a write-down of slow-moving stock in the Calder Valley warehouse, chiefly unsold Pexlin fittings from last season. Finance will book the adjustment this quarter. Branch managers must verify local counts by month-end and flag any items eligible for clearance sale rather than disposal. Questions go to D. Prentiss. Further context on next year's direction is set out below.

board note of tadup-tajog: Headcount on the Oliiel team goes from 31 to 88 by the end of February. Gross margin on Oliiel came in at 62 percent against a plan of 29 percent.

# Env file — Cartwheel dispatch, driver-assignment heuristic
# Scope: staging only. Do not promote to prod.
# The heuristic weights (proximity, shift balance, refusal rate) are tuned
# for the Velmont pilot region and will misbehave elsewhere.
# Review notes: heuristic service runs unprivileged; it reads weights
# read-only from the tuning store and writes nothing back.
# Only one sensitive value exists in this file: the tuning-store access
# credential, consumed at boot and never logged.
# That credential is set on the following line.

secret setting of faduf-bahop: LEDGER_TOKEN8=c3b363be

MEMO — Welcome aboard! Quick heads-up on the Lanterbrook pilot: we've got twelve stores in the Marrowvale region running our Shelfwise kiosks since October. Early numbers look decent — basket size up, returns flat. Tomas from merch ops is your go-to. Lanterbrook wants a decision on the full rollout by spring. Before your first call with them, read the note below.

internal memo for faweg-tafog: Only 7 of the 100 pilot accounts renewed Quenael, so a churn review is set for April 15.

ENG SYNC NOTE — Tallyforge billing worker. Last week's blue-green cutover stalled because the green environment was cloned from a stale template: the worker booted against the blue queue and double-processed two invoice batches. We've since split the env files per color and added a preflight check that refuses to start if the deploy color doesn't match the queue prefix. The green .env is now correct except for one credential. The broker auth token for the green worker goes on the line directly below.

vault entry, kahop-kagug: RELAY_SECRET3=6ea